It is believed that William and Harriet had at least eight children; but it should be noted that ten are listed on Family Search - more research is needed for verification:
1. Mary "Polly" Ann Harmon (1848–after 1860)
Listed on the 1850 Census as Polly, listed on the 1860 Census as Polly Ann
2. Elizabeth "Betsy" Harmon (1849–1939)
Listed on the 1850 Census as Betsy, listed on the 1860 Census and the 1870 Census as Elisabeth
At this time a record of death is needed to verify his exact date of death. He is listed on the 1880 Census and it is believed that he passed away about 1891. His wife is listed as widowed by the time the 1900 Census was taken.
